Proposal
Change of use of land from agricultural land to farm park, wildlife and outdoor activity centre, associated buildings and outdoor play structures, mountain bike trail, formation of lake, ponds and wetland area, area for glamping tents, site manager's accommodation, formation of a new access off the A415, alteration of two existing accesses (from Thame Lane and A415), creation of new pedestrian access off A415, associated engineering works, drainage and landscaping (as amended / clarified by plans / documents received 5 July 2018,18 July 2018, 23 July 2018, 6 August 2018, 1 October 2018, 31 October 2018, 20 November 2018, 8 February 2019, 11 February 2019, 14 February 2019 and 15 February 2019).
As published by the council, reference P17/S4416/FUL

About full applications
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go, with siting, design, access and landscaping all fixed at this stage. More in our guide to planning application types.
